Mute and deaf man hangs self

Nagpur: A 23-year-old mute and deaf man hanged himself on the door of a lift on the terrace of his building at Nandanvan on Tuesday. The deceased, Akshay Deshmukh, a private sector employee, was found hanging by his brother Kunal.
Police have recovered a note from Akshay’s person. However, senior PI Vinayak Chavhan claimed that no conclusion can be drawn from the contents of the letter. “We will verify the letter and the writing,” said Chavhan.
According to police, Akshay was mute and deaf. His father had died in an accident near Buti Bori two years ago, while his mother was also injured in the accident.
It is learnt, Akshay, a nephew of MLA Krishna Khopde, had joined his company about six months back and was tensed for last some days.
On Tuesday, after returning home from work Akshay went to the terrace without informing anyone. Late in the night, Kunal started searching for Akshay. After discovering his body on the terrace, Kunal called up his relatives and police.

Nandanvan police sent the body to Government Medical College and Hospital (GMCH) after completing panchnama.
On Wednesday, post-mortem was conducted on Akshay at GMCH. The last rites were performed at Gangabai Ghat.
